Environment the Key to Pest Management
27 February 2002
This day course is aimed at anyone with any involvement with, or
responsibility for care of, archives and collections.
Course tutor David Pinniger, Independent Consultant Entomologist. He
is
the pest management strategy adviser for English Heritage and many of
the
major UK museums.
Course objectives
To introduce the main agents of bioderterioration, moulds and insects
What they need to live
How to identify them
The damage they cause
Ways to prevent them becoming established
Ways to control them if they do
Understanding the pests environments
Carrying out a practical survey
Making plans to establish Integrated Pest Management
The publication 'Integrated Pest Management' will be provided to all
delegates
